Metal and hard rock label Season Of Mist have announced that they have decided to delay the physical releases of their immediate albums in the wake of restrictions and complications arising from the Coronavirus pandemic. Digital releases will still go ahead as planned however. The label said in a statement:
“Season of Mist IMPORTANT update:
So far, the lockdown hasn’t affected our warehouses in the US and France yet and remain OPEN for the time being.
We don’t know for how long, so if you plan on getting music to keep you company for the next month or so, do it now! According to the latest news, we will still be able to ship all our orders this week. We have two teams rotating, so in case one gets quarantined, another one will take its place.
We will ship until we’re told we can’t.
About release dates : we’ll keep on releasing new albums as planned, digitally. Because in time of war, disease & uncertainty, Nextflix is certainly not enough.
So we decided to keep releasing music digitally. We’ll delay all our physical release dates, but our eshop customers will get a download code, and streaming will go live as planned.
